mitrᵊdāt מִתְרְדָת ‘Mithredath’ (Hebrew)

Etymology?: of Persian origin

mitrᵊdāt pr n m pers
Mithredath = "given by Mithra"
1) treasurer of king Cyrus of Persia
2) a Persian officer stationed at Samaria in the time of Artaxerxes

Mentioned in Ezra 4:7, 1:8
